National Interstate is looking for a Learning and Development Leader to join their team. This individual will work a hybrid schedule out of the Richfield, OH office.
Essential Job Functions and Responsibilities
- Conducts and designs company learning and educational programs relating to management and professional development, on-the-job training, skills readiness, and employee orientation. May also serve as an instructor for employee/leadership development and/or technical training curriculum.
- Coaches individual employees and managers related to performance, leadership, and professional development. Assesses the effectiveness of coaching engagements. Leads the work of others (mentors, prioritizes, delegates, and reviews assignments).
- Drives curriculum/program design and enhancements.
- Selects and develops appropriate instructional methods for courses, such as individual coaching, group instruction, lectures, demonstrations, conferences, meetings, and workshops.
- Selects and develops learning aids, such as training handbooks, demonstration models, visual aids, and learning materials.
- Develops schedules and programs.
- Coordinates training activities with company management to ensure a smooth, efficient process.
- Identifies courses that aid development of specific competencies.
- Researches and recommends services provided by external consultants or organizations. Participates in negotiations and/or administering contract/service agreements. Secures appropriate approval. Participates in assessing the effectiveness and/or partnerships with vendors.
- Partners with senior management to assess short-term and long-term training needs for business/functional units and their employees. Engages customers in conversations to identify their needs for new/additional programs, courses or services.
- Develops specifications for learning and development equipment and systems, including online learning tools and learning management systems (LMS).
- Monitors and reports on the effectiveness of training. Recommends appropriate research methods to assess the effectiveness of training.
- Responsible for organizational award process and submissions, along with data review and debriefs.
- Maintains expert knowledge of the organization, adult learning principles, current trends in employee education, informal learning methods, and opportunities to leverage social media.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
Job Requirements
Education: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ent. Master’s Degree preferred.
Field of Study: Human Resources, Human Resource Development, Business, Education, Instructional Design or related discipline.
Experience: Generally, a minimum of 14 years of related experience. Completion of a professional designation preferred, appropriate designations could include Professional in Human Resources (PHR), Senior Professional in Human Resources (SPHR), Certified Professional in Talent Development (CPTD) or an Insurance designation.
